James L. McDonel is a scholar working on Infectious Diseases, Food Science and Molecular Biology. According to data from OpenAlex, James L. McDonel has authored 10 papers receiving a total of 573 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Infectious Diseases, 5 papers in Food Science and 4 papers in Molecular Biology. Recurrent topics in James L. McDonel's work include Clostridium difficile and Clostridium perfringens research (6 papers), Probiotics and Fermented Foods (5 papers) and Viral gastroenteritis research and epidemiology (4 papers). James L. McDonel is often cited by papers focused on Clostridium difficile and Clostridium perfringens research (6 papers), Probiotics and Fermented Foods (5 papers) and Viral gastroenteritis research and epidemiology (4 papers). James L. McDonel collaborates with scholars based in United States. James L. McDonel's co-authors include Bruce A. McClane and Friedrich Dorner and has published in prestigious journals such as Biochemistry, Biochemical and Biophysical Research Communications and Methods in enzymology on CD-ROM/Methods in enzymology.
